Most 2 years olds can: follow a 2 step instruction, use more than 50 words (half will be unintelligible), make phrases of 2 or more words, use simple plurals and personal pronouns, and know the names of close friends and family. . Speech/language- red flags •The child does not: •Coo with pleasure- 3 months •Babble - 6 months •Understands 'no', 'bye bye'- 9 months •Understands own name, 1-2 words- 12 months •10-20+ words- 18 months •50-70% speech intelligible, 2 word phrases- 24 months *Stiff arms and legs.
